Rochester General Hospital is currently seeking outstanding
applicants for a full-time Oral Maxillofacial surgeon to join our
robust and growing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ery department in the
role of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ery Residency Program
Director.
This is an extraordinary opportunity for an enthusiastic and
motivated surgeon to lead the OMFS residency from its inception.
Rochester Regional Health and the Graduate Medical Education
programs are committed to the long-term success of the residency,
including providing faculty support and resident recruitment
coordination. This position entails responsibilities in both
didactic/clinical teaching and supervision of residents in the oral
and maxillofacial surgery inaugural program. Providing direct
patient care as part of the faculty practice, including trauma
on-call coverage, participation in research programs and other
collaborative activities within Rochester Regional Health are
essential parts of the role.
This position offers the opportunity to develop a diverse and
challenging academic oral and maxillofacial surgery curriculum,
mentor residents, and participate in professional collaboration and
leadership development activities.
This opportunity will appeal to candidates who have a passion for
providing care to all patient populations including the
underserved. Priority will be given to Oral-Maxillofacial Surgeons
with previous experience in hospital dentistry, community health
centers, dental education and leadership.
Candidates need to possess excellent interpersonal and
communication skills in order to relate to groups at all levels
within the organization, including office staff, attending
dentists, and senior leadership; must display initiative, a
positive attitude, flexibility and commitment to department goals
and objectives; must be committed to the highest standards of
ethical and professional conduct.
Requires a DDS/DMD degree from a CODA accredited US or Canadian
dental school, completion of a CODA-approved oral and maxillofacial
surgery residency program, board certification by the American
Board of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ery and a NY dental license.
